The Japan Rum Association (a very prestigious organisation, we're sure) puts on quite a show at Shibuya's Vision: organised in cooperation with the embassies of rum-producing countries like Cuba, Guatemala, Jamaica, Haiti and Panama, this boozy bash invites visitors to drink all the rum they can manage for a set price, while Caribbean and Brazilian food is available for ¥500 a pop. The stage will be manned by artists, DJs and bands from the above-mentioned countries, along with quite a few local acts, so expect laidback tunes, colourful performances and a sunny atmosphere.
